What size is my Weber charcoal grill?
The actual measurements of our charcoal grills remain the same: 18.5”, 22.5” and 26.75”.
What size Weber should I get?
The main factor to consider before determining what size barbecue you need is the number of people you wish to cook for. With gas barbecues, you usually have the option of multiple burners. For medium crowds, it’s recommended to use three to four burners, and for larger groups, Weber offers as many as six burners.

How long should you keep the Weber rotisserie on?
Note that Weber only recommends keeping the rotisserie burner on for the first 10 to 15 minutes of cooking. Longer than that will cause the outside of your food to be overdone.) No matter what you are to cooking, use with indirect medium-low heat and the temperature should stay right around 350F.
How do you use a rotisserie spit on a Weber grill?
Grab the spit with heat safe gloves or oven mitts. Plug the point of the spit into the rotisserie motor. Lower the notch on the spit into the groove on the other side of the grill. (The groove is in the rotisserie ring for a charcoal grill, or is built into the side of the firebox for a gas grill.)
